Вычислить сумму чисел - C (СИ)
Формулировка задачи:
подскажите как сделать чтобы выводилась сумма этих чисел
и вот программа
Листинг программы
- #include <stdio.h>
- #include <conio.h>
- void main (void)
- {
- float A[10][10],k,x;
- int m,n,i,j,summ=0;
- printf ("введите количество строк:\n");
- scanf ("%i", &m);
- printf ("введите количество столбцов:\n");
- scanf ("%i", &n);
- printf ("введите х\n");
- scanf ("%f", &k);
- for (i=0; i<m; i++) {
- printf ("введите элементы строки %2i\n");
- for (j=0; j<n; j++)
- scanf ("%f", &A[i][j]);
- }
- printf ("исходная матрица\n");
- for (i=0; i<m; i++) {
- for (j=0; j<n; j++)
- printf ("%8.3f", A[i][j]);
- printf ("\n");
- }
- for (i=0; i<m; i++)
- for (j=0; j<n; j++) {
- summ +=i+j;
- printf ("(%i, %i)", i, j);
- }
- getch ();
- }
Решение задачи: «Вычислить сумму чисел»
textual
Листинг программы
- printf ("\n summa indexov = %i", summ);
Объяснение кода листинга программы
Код представлен одним предложением и выполняет следующие шаги:
- Выводит значение переменной
summ
с помощью функции printf. - Значение переменной
summ
вычисляется как сумма элементов массиваindex
. - Каждый элемент массива
index
последовательно добавляется к переменнойsumm
. - Количество элементов в массиве
index
равно 20. - Каждый элемент массива
index
имеет тип данных int (целое число). - Значения элементов массива
index
инициализируются случайными целыми числами. - Переменная
summ
инициализируется нулем. - Переменная
i
инициализируется нулем. - Цикл выполняется 20 раз.
- Внутри цикла переменная
i
увеличивается на единицу. - Каждый элемент массива
index
с индексомi
добавляется к переменнойsumm
. - Значение переменной
summ
выводится на экран с помощью функции printf.
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д